Specifications
Specifications
Effect types 86 types
Maximum number of
simultaneous effects
6
Number of patch memories
50
Sampling frequency 44.1kHz
A/D conversion 24-bit with 128x oversampling
D/A conversion 24-bit with 128x oversampling
Signal processing 32-bit floating point & 32-bit fixed point
Frequency characteristics
20-20kHz (+1dB/3dB) (10kΩ load)
Display LCD
Input Standard monaural phone jack x 2
Rated input level: 20dBm, Input impedance 1MΩ
Output Standard monaural phone jack x 2
Maximum output level: Line +5dBm (with output load impedance of 10 kΩ or more)
Power
AC adapter DC9V (center minus plug), 500 mA (ZOOM AD-16)
Batteries
Continuous operation using 2 AA alkaline batteries for about 7 hours with mono input or
about 5 hours with stereo input
USB
Dimensions 130.3mm(D) x 77.5mm(W) x 58.5mm(H)
USB Firmware update
Weight 360g
t0dBm=0.775Vrms
